In this session, Jen Welser, Molly McAllister, Rustin Moore, and Jules Benson will explore the high-level trends and responses to the Spectrum of Care within veterinary medicine. As access to care becomes a growing concern, both academic institutions and corporate practices are adapting their approaches to meet the diverse needs of patients and clients. This discussion will focus on the systemic changes underway, examining how these sectors are responding to the challenges of affordability, accessibility, and quality of care._x000D_
_x000D_
Learning Outcomes:_x000D_
-Understand the broader social and economic forces driving the need for expanded access to veterinary care._x000D_
-Learn how academic institutions are researching and teaching the Spectrum of Care to future veterinarians._x000D_
-Discover how corporate practices are evolving their models to address disparities in access to care._x000D_
-Gain insights into the role of leadership in advancing equitable care across diverse patient populations.
